Permeate is a dairy ingredient that is produced after the removal of protein and other ingredients from milk or whey and is rich in lactose content. It is one of the cost-effective alternatives to expensive ingredients that are used to add salty flavor to food items. Permeate is used in various applications, such as bakery, prepared meals, soup, and others. Moreover, high lactose in permeate results in a brown appearance and caramelized aroma in baked products. Permeate is also used as an alternative to whole milk powder and skim milk. 1.What is permeate, and how is it produced?

Permeate is a co-product of the milk and dairy industry, obtained through the process of ultrafiltration of milk to separate proteins and fat from lactose and minerals. It is essentially the lactose, vitamins, and minerals found in milk.

3.Are there different types or grades of permeate available in the North American market?

Permeate can vary in composition and quality depending on the processing methods and the source of the milk. Common types include dairy permeate, whey permeate, and lactose permeate, each with specific applications in the food industry.
